When should you forward mail when moving?

It’s therefore a good idea to submit the forwarding request at least two weeks before your move if possible. This will ensure that nothing is missed in the first few days after you move. Once mail forwarding begins, the USPS will forward most of your mail for up to one year.

What happens if mail gets sent to old address?

The carrier will take the mail back to the post office of origin. The post office will forward it if they have a forwarding address, but if not, they will send the mail back to the sender. If the envelope has a barcode, the post office uses an automated system to sort the mail.

How do I forward my email to a new address?

  1. On your computer, open Gmail using the account you want to forward messages from. …
  2. In the top right, click Settings. …
  3. Click the Forwarding and POP/IMAP tab.
  4. In the Forwarding section, click Add a forwarding address.
  5. Enter the email address you want to forward messages to.
  6. Click Next Proceed.

What mail Cannot be forwarded?

Standard Mail A (circulars, books, catalogs, and advertising mail) is not forwarded unless requested by the mailer. Standard Mail B (packages weighing 16 ounces or more) are forwarded locally for 12 months at no charge. You pay forwarding charges if you move outside the local area.

How do I stop mail from going to my old address?

Please visit USPS Hold Mail Service to submit a request online. You will need to sign in to or create a USPS.com® account to begin an online USPS Hold Mail request. You can enter an online USPS Hold Mail request up to 30 days in advance of the start date or as early as the next scheduled delivery day.
